Internal Memo — Divestment of the Quillard Unit

Sales leads: negotiations to sell the Quillard services unit are progressing carefully and remain strictly internal. Customer commitments will be honoured through transition, and your pipelines are unaffected for now. Please route any partner questions to the divestment team rather than answering directly. The confidential note on the plan follows.

internal memo for kawip-hadug: Headcount on the Wenwyn team goes from 7 to 140 by the end of January. Gross margin on Wenwyn came in at 20 percent against a plan of 15 percent.

## SDK parity

We ship two client SDKs for Meridex: one for Kestrel and one for Plover. They track the same API surface, but Plover lags roughly one release behind on streaming endpoints. Your first task is running the parity test suite, which diffs method coverage across both SDKs nightly. The suite calls our internal compatibility service, and it authenticates with the key below.

service key, tadup-tahog: zpat7_wB1tnEL

PR: Harden Driftway parcel-tracking webhook against duplicate carrier events. Adds idempotency keys, dedupe cache, and bounded retries with jitter. No schema changes; consumers unaffected. Tested against the Larkfield staging carrier simulator with replayed duplicate bursts. Reviewers: focus on the dedupe TTL and retry ceiling. The new tuning constants introduced by this change are listed below.

tuning constants:
QUOTAS = {
    "druwyn": 5,
    "holix": 5,
    "zorath": 5,
    "holwyn": 10,
}

# Break-Glass: Catalog Cache Invalidation

Scope: the Pinrow product catalog at Veldstone Retail. If stale prices persist after a purge and the Hollowmere invalidation queue is wedged, use break-glass to flush the edge tier directly. Contractors: get verbal sign-off from the catalog lead first. Steps: open the Hollowmere admin shell, select emergency-flush, confirm the tenant, and run it once — repeated flushes thrash the origin. Access is logged and expires after 20 minutes. Unseal the admin shell with the passphrase below.

recovery phrase for kahop-tajog: istix-casvan